Featured dishes

View full menu
Shrimp Patty Wrapped In Bean Curd Skin
(Serving) (tàu hủ kỳ)
Shrimp Paste
(Serving) (chao tôm)
Egg Rolls
(Chả giò)
Pork Spring Rolls
Charbroiled pork meatball wrapped in rice paper (nem nướng cuốn)
Summer Rolls
Shrimp and pork wrapped in rice paper (gỏi cuốn)

This place used to be affordable! Started going here when we moved to La Habra back in 2010, price was $7 large bowl Flank or Shrimp Pho, they also give you extra soup if needed for free! Also the employees was 10 times better than what they have now (can't stand the rude lady that works there now, very unprofessional) miss those young ladies including the daughter of the owner, way better customer service then. They started increasing the price around 2015 to around $10 or $12 for a large bowl and started eliminating the free extra soup. Now, like everyone else using the pandemic till today as an excuse to milk every penny from everyone, they've sky rocketed their price to $15 plus for a large bowl which put them the same as to those with better service and better quality Pho like SUP in Buena Park which we now go to which charges $16.50 but, with unlimited noodles and bigger servings! Do not recommend. Service is scary fast, to the point where you are certain none of the food is being made fresh. If you're in a rush, this place works great. Unfortunately, they use low grade ingredients, and the taste is bad. We got the pho and the egg rolls. The pho used beef that wasn't fresh, and the broth tasted very off. It seems they use tap water in their broth, and their tap water has a distinct taste that takes away from the flavor heavily. The egg roll dipping sauce is unfortunately diluted down with water. Literally half of it was water, and none of it would actually stick to our rolls. The viscosity was a joke. They do not respect the customer, and try their hardest to fool their customer and maximize their profit at your expense. Stay away.
Dan BroadheadDan Broadhead
I'm not usually a big fan of pho, but this place would be an exception. This is the best pho restaurant I've ever been to. The beef ball egg noodle soup was excellent. Huge portions, like more than I should have eaten. The preparation and presentation were great. The price was a great deal for what you're getting. The service was friendly and attentive. What's not to like?
T TranT Tran
The food is quite good here. The Beef Banh Mi was very fresh and crispy, and they stuffed it with a lot of meat. The Rice Noodle Vermicelli with Grilled Chicken was really tasty and filling. Everything was for takeout. It is now open for indoor dining.
